Container Census
A Go-based tool that scans configured Docker hosts and tracks all running containers. Container information is timestamped and stored in a database, accessible through a web frontend. The entire stack runs in a single container.
Features
- Multi-host scanning: Monitor multiple Docker hosts from a single dashboard
- Lightweight Agent: Deploy agents on remote hosts for easy, secure connectivity
- Simple UI-based setup: Add remote hosts by just entering IP/URL and token
- Automatic scanning: Configurable periodic scans (default: every 5 minutes)
- Historical tracking: All container states are timestamped and stored
- Web UI: Clean, responsive web interface with real-time updates
- REST API: Full API access to all container and host data
- Container management: Start, stop, restart, remove containers, and view logs
- Image management: List, remove, and prune images across all hosts
- Single container deployment: Everything runs in one lightweight container
- Multiple connection types: Agent (recommended), Unix socket, TCP, and SSH connections
- Anonymous telemetry (optional): Track container usage trends with privacy-first design
Quick Start
Using Docker Compose (Recommended)
The easiest way to get started:
Server (requried)
census-server:
image: ghcr.io/selfhosters-cc/container-census:latest
container_name: census-server
restart: unless-stopped
group_add:
- "${DOCKER_GID:-999}"
ports:
- "8080:8080"
volumes:
# Docker socket for scanning local containers
- /var/run/docker.sock:/var/run/docker.sock
# Persistent data directory
- ./census/server:/app/data
# Optional: Mount custom config file
# Uncomment to use a custom configuration
#- ./census/config.yaml:/app/config/config.yaml
- ./census/config:/app/config
environment:
# Optional: Override config path
# CONFIG_PATH: /app/config/config.yaml
AUTH_ENABLED: false
AUTH_USERNAME: your_username
AUTH_PASSWORD: your_secure_password
# Timezone
TZ: ${TZ:-UTC}
healthcheck:
test: ["CMD", "wget", "--no-verbose", "--tries=1", "--spider", "http://localhost:8080/api/health"]
interval: 30s
timeout: 3s
retries: 3
start_period: 10s

Configuration
Get the API token from logs:
docker logs census-agent | grep "API Token"
Add in the UI of the server:
- Click "+ Add Agent Host" button
- Enter host name, agent URL (
http://host-ip:9876), and token - Click "Test Connection" then "Add Agent"

API Endpoints for the Server
Hosts
GET /api/hosts- List all configured hostsGET /api/hosts/{id}- Get specific host details
Containers
GET /api/containers- Get latest containers from all hostsGET /api/containers/host/{id}- Get containers for specific hostGET /api/containers/history?start=TIME&end=TIME- Get historical container data
Scanning
POST /api/scan- Trigger a manual scanGET /api/scan/results?limit=N- Get recent scan results
Health
GET /api/health- Health check endpoint

Project Structure
cmd/server/main.go- Server application entry pointcmd/agent/main.go- Agent application entry pointinternal/scanner/- Docker host connection and container discoveryinternal/agent/- Agent server implementationinternal/storage/- SQLite database operations with full CRUDinternal/api/- HTTP handlers and routinginternal/models/- Data structures shared across packagesweb/- Static frontend files served by the Go applicationscripts/- Utility scripts for building and deployment

Troubleshooting
Cannot connect to Docker daemon
- Ensure Docker socket is mounted:
-v /var/run/docker.sock:/var/run/docker.sock - Check socket permissions
- Verify Docker is running on the host
Permission denied
- The container runs as non-root user (UID 1000)
- Ensure mounted volumes have correct permissions
- For Docker socket, user needs to be in
dockergroup on host
Remote host connection fails
- Verify network connectivity
- Check firewall rules
- For TCP: Ensure Docker API is exposed on remote host
Database errors
- Ensure data directory is writable
- Check disk space
- Verify SQLite3 is properly compiled (CGO_ENABLED=1)
